Position Summary:

This driver role supports and assists transportation leadership by overseeing and providing guidance to assigned driver teams usually at remote shuttle yard locations. Assistance may include but is not limited to managing work schedules, training, solving customer delivery issues, new hire onboarding, performing safety checks and preferred work method observations and other related duties. The

Lead Driver drives a tractor trailer or straight truck intrastate and/or interstate on local, over-the-toad (OTR), shuttle, and/or overnight routes to deliver and unload various food and food related products to customers. All routes are expected to be completed safely in accordance with all Company policies and Department of Transportation (DOT) regulations. The driver communicates and interacts

with customers, vendors and co-workers professionally ensuring all services and duties are executed in accordance with preferred work methods and customer service practices. Functions as a team member within the department and organization, as required, and perform any duty assigned to best serve the company.

Position Responsibilities:
  • Perform all required safety checks (i.e. pre/post trip) including inspections of tractor/truck and trailer according to Department of

    Transportation (DOT) regulations; inspect tractor/truck and trailer to insure they meet company safety standards and take appropriate

    action as needed. Report all safety issues and/or repairs required.
  • Follow all DOT regulations and company safe driving guidelines and policies. Immediately report any and all safety hazards.
  • Assists in day-to-day oversight of all assigned drivers to ensure safe and timely delivery of all customer orders. Performs additional

    administrative duties as assigned.
  • Inspect trailer for properly loaded and secured freight. Perform count check of items and check customer invoices of products that

    have been loaded. Check and complete in an accurate and in legible fashion all required paperwork associated with freight. Load customer returns on to trailer and secure trailer doors.
  • Drive to and deliver customer orders according to predetermined route delivery schedule.
  • Unload products from the trailer, transport items into designated customer storage areas. Perform damage control checks on items,

    scanning and contact supervisor about removing orders according to company policy. Verify delivery of items with customer and

    obtain proper signatures. Collect money (cash or checks) where required. Load customer returns on to trailer and secure trailer doors
  • Ensure that tractor, trailer and freight are appropriately locked and/or secured at all times.
  • Unload damaged goods and customer returns and bring to the driver check-in and complete necessary paperwork. Unload all

    equipment, materials and remove trash from trailers as required.
  • Complete daily record of hours of service and enter in log in accordance with Federal DOT, state and company requirements.
  • Perform general housekeeping duties in tractor, loading dock area and keep trailers clear and clean as required. At the end of the

    shift secure all equipment and complete all necessary paperwork
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
